The History and Symbolism of the Shofar
The shofar, a ram’s horn, has been used in Jewish tradition for thousands of years. Its origins can be traced back to biblical times, where it was used as a call to gather or as a signal during battle. Most significantly, the shofar is sounded during the High Holy Days of Rosh Hashanah and Yom Kippur, serving as a spiritual alarm clock to awaken the soul and inspire introspection and repentance.
Symbolically, the shofar represents a deep connection to Jewish history and faith. The sound of the shofar is a reminder of the binding of Isaac, a story of faith and obedience, and it serves as a call to remembrance and spiritual renewal.
How the Shofar is Used in Jewish Practice
During Rosh Hashanah, the Jewish New Year, the shofar is sounded as a central part of the synagogue service. The sound patterns, known as Tekiah, Shevarim, and Teruah, each have unique meanings and evoke different spiritual responses. On Yom Kippur, the conclusion of the Day of Atonement, the final blast of the shofar marks the end of the fast and the closing of the gates of repentance.
Beyond the High Holy Days, the shofar may be sounded at the end of a fast or during other religious events, symbolizing freedom, redemption, and spiritual awakening.
